Prayer to God to Establish Your Steps
Heavenly Father,
As I rise to meet this new day, I place my feet and my heart firmly in Your hands.
You see every path before me, every choice I must make, and every challenge that waits just beyond what I can see.
Lord, establish my steps today.
Guide me with a wisdom that is gentle but sure, steadying me when I feel uncertain and lifting me when I feel weary.
Let Your Spirit go before me into every conversation, every responsibility, and every hidden moment of grace You have prepared.
When I am tempted to rush ahead on my own strength, slow me down.
When fear or doubt causes me to hesitate, strengthen me to move forward with courage.
Teach me to walk at the pace of trust, not anxiety.
May every step I take today reflect Your goodness.
Help me to choose kindness over irritation, patience over frustration, generosity over self-concern, and peace over worry.
When distractions swirl around me, draw me back to You.
When unexpected burdens arise, remind me that I do not carry them alone.
Lord, sanctify the work of my hands and the movements of my day.
Order my priorities with clarity.
Keep my heart pure, my thoughts centered on Christ, and my spirit open to the gentle nudges of the Holy Spirit.
Let my path be secure not because I know what is ahead, but because You walk beside me.
Lord, establish my steps today and plant them firmly on the path that leads to Your peace, Your purpose, and Your joy.
Amen.
Walking in God’s Rhythm
Scripture reminds us, “The steps of a good person are ordered by the Lord.” This is not a promise of a trouble-free day, but of a God-guided one. When we pray for God to establish our steps, we surrender our desire to control everything and instead trust in His divine timing.
In a world that moves quickly, God invites us to slow down and walk at the pace of grace. Some days He opens doors; other days He gently closes them. Some days He nudges us forward; other days He teaches us to wait. Each moment becomes holy when we trust that God is shaping our path.
Walking with God means choosing attentiveness over worry. It means believing that our smallest decisions matter to Him. Whether it be the tone we use with a loved one, the patience we show in a difficult moment, the courage we summon when we feel unsure.
When we allow God to order our steps, we become more aware of His presence in the ordinary rhythm of the day. The moments that once felt scattered begin to align with purpose. Our hearts settle. Our minds quiet. And we discover that God’s guidance is not a distant promise but a daily reality.
